Howard Dean began his presidential big at number eight of a dozen potential Democrat contenders in May 2002. In March 2003 he gave a speech critical of party leadership at the California Democratic Convention that attracted the attention of grassroots activists and set the tone of his candidacy. By Fall 2003, Dean had become the front-runner, with an army of supporters known as 'Deaniacs' behind him. Things were looking good for Dean, but at an energetic rally on the evening of January 19, 2004, Dean emitted a shrieking scream that many claim ended his political career. The “Dean Scream,” as it quickly came to be known, was a unique and revealing moment in early-21st century American politics.
